Researchers have introduced MASS (Motion-Aligned Selective Scan), a novel framework for video frame interpolation that addresses challenges posed by large, non-linear motions and occlusions. Unlike previous methods that use static grid-based scanning, MASS reformulates feature scanning along dynamic motion trajectories. It employs a learnable non-linear path integration and a velocity-aware State Space Model (SSM) to adaptively sample features, dedicating more attention to fast-moving regions. This approach has demonstrated state-of-the-art results on standard benchmarks, particularly in complex dynamic scenarios. AI
